Transaction cef3186cb78b4406f913892fa67c436567a7749e4e8a676ea70f8de61e76ce22
1 Input
1 Output
-
cef3186cb78b4406f913892fa67c436567a7749e4e8a676ea70f8de61e76ce22:0
- value
- 361849718
- script pubkey
- OP_0 OP_PUSHBYTES_20 1fa754f93c65c25870960d8dde8f6385b7ede732
- address
- bc1qr7n4f7fuvhp9suykpkxaarmrskm7meej2j9k5r